Insufficient board refreshment.Reported Earnings • Sep 30First half 2022 earnings released: EPS: €0.29 (vs €0.072 in 1H 2021)First half 2022 results: EPS: €0.29 (up from €0.072 in 1H 2021). Revenue: €131.5m (up 46% from 1H 2021). Net income: €6.98m (up 305% from 1H 2021). Profit margin: 5.3% (up from 1.9% in 1H 2021). The increase in margin was driven by higher revenue. Over the last 3 years on average, earnings per share has increased by 84% per year but the company’s share price has only increased by 21% per year, which means it is significantly lagging earnings growth.Valuation Update With 7 Day Price Move • Sep 15Investor sentiment improved over the past weekAfter last week's 17% share price gain to €1.55, the stock trades at a trailing P/E ratio of 8.8x. Location: LARISA, 5th KLM LARISSA-ATHENS Athens GreeceReported Earnings • May 05Full year 2021 earnings released: EPS: €0.17 (vs €0.009 in FY 2020)Full year 2021 results: EPS: €0.17 (up from €0.009 in FY 2020). Revenue: €187.3m (up 52% from FY 2020). Net income: €4.21m (up €3.99m from FY 2020). Profit margin: 2.2% (up from 0.2% in FY 2020). The increase in margin was driven by higher revenue. Over the last 3 years on average, earnings per share has increased by 62% per year but the company’s share price has only increased by 33% per year, which means it is significantly lagging earnings growth.Board Change • Apr 27No independent directorsNo new directors have joined the board in the last 3 years.
